About this book

The book retraces the history of the Italian Association of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ics (AIMETA) since its establishment in 1965. AIMETA is the official Italian association of mechanics adhering to IUTAM (International Union of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ics), which organizes and coordinates a meaningful number of research activities, the most important of which are the biennial National Congress and the internationally renowned journal “Meccanica”, published by Springer. Besides collecting and organizing all related important data and information, as far as possible, by distinguishing among the five scientific areas – general mechanics, solids, structures, fluids, machines – encompassed by AIMETA, the history of the association is assumed as a proper perspective to overview the evolution of theoretical and applied mechanics in Italy over about the last fifty years. This is accomplished in the first part of the book. with also a specific focus on the mechanics of solids and structures, where the biographies of a meaningful number of recognized Italian scholars of mechanics in all areas are also provided, along with testimonials and memories by a few senior people meaningfully involved with AIMETA and Italian mechanics. The second part gives an account, although unavoidably incomplete, of recent developments of mechanical sciences in Italy, as reflected also in the activities of AIMETA and with reference to the international context. Contributions by a number of invited senior scholars, still very active, consist of overviews on some scientific themes in the various areas, summaries of achievements of research groups, expressions of research viewpoints, prospects for future developments.

About the editor

AIMETA is the Italian Association of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ics. The Italian adhering association to IUTAM (International Union of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ics), since its foundation in 1965 it has played a major role in the development of the Italian community of mechanics, and has promoted the mechanical sciences and the advancement of human society.

Giuseppe Rega is Professor Emeritus at Sapienza University of Rome, Italy. He served as AIMETA’s president in 2006-2009, and as Editor-in-Chief of Springer journal “Meccanica”. In 2017 he received the ASME Lyapunov Award for his lifelong contributions to the field of nonlinear dynamics.
